Soft wax is the wax with paper/cloth strips! Usually people do this for the legs? Soft wax is stickier. Hard wax does not come with the paper strips. In general, hard wax is used to remove hair from more sensitive areas (bikini line, armpits, etc.). During pregnancy you will be more sensitive to pain. Do ask your beauty aesthetician to do a test wax on a small area. If you have extremely sensitive skin, do consult your obgyn before deciding on anything :) There is more information here: http://www.healthline.com/health/pregnancy/waxing#4
